ICMR gets nod for drone trials for delivering vaccines
[ad_1]
The Ministry of Civil Aviation and the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A) have granted permission to the Indian Council of Medical Research to conduct trials for supply of COVID-19 vaccines utilizing drones.
The ICMR will conduct the feasibility research in collaboration with IIT Kanpur for which permission has been granted for one 12 months.
Drones within the nation are allowed for use inside the visible vary, and businesses have to hunt particular permission from the Civil Aviation Ministry for conducting trials past the visible line of sight.
